+"""Display general purpose debug drawing."""
+from simu.inter.drawable import Drawable
+
+class DebugDraw (Drawable):
+
+ def __init__ (self, onto, model):
+ Drawable.__init__ (self, onto)
+ self.model = model
+ self.model.register (self.__notified)
+ self.__colors = ('red', 'blue', 'green', 'yellow')
+
+ def __notified (self):
+ self.update ()
+
+ def draw (self):
+ self.reset ()
+ for d in self.model.drawing:
+ if d[0] == 'circle':
+ self.draw_circle ((d[1], d[2]), d[3],
+ outline = self.__colors[d[4]])
+ elif d[0] == 'segment':
+ self.draw_line ((d[1], d[2]), (d[3], d[4]),
+ fill = self.__colors[d[5]])
+ elif d[0] == 'point':
+ s = 15
+ x, y = d[1], d[2]
+ self.draw_line (
+ (x - s, y - s), (x + s, y + s),
+ (x - s, y + s), (x + s, y - s),
+ (x - s, y - s), fill = self.__colors[d[3]])
+ else:
+ raise ValueError
+
